Narda Ipakchi is a senior analyst with Manatt Health Solutions, an interdisciplinary policy and business advisory division of Manatt, Phelps & Phillips, LLP. She provides policy research and analysis, project implementation support and other business services to a wide array of healthcare clients, including providers, insurers, pharmaceutical companies, foundations and vendors. Ms. Ipakchi's areas of focus include pharmaceutical and biotechnology policy and reimbursement issues and healthcare reform implementation. She is also responsible for tracking federal and state policy issues and provides analytical support on developments relating to public health insurance (including Medicare, Medicaid and CHIP), health information technology and disease management, among others.
Prior to joining MHS, Ms. Ipakchi was a senior associate in the data analytics division of Avalere Health LLC, a health policy consulting firm based in Washington, D.C. In this role, she managed a team of associates in conducting quantitative analyses for pharmaceutical manufacturers regarding changes in drug coverage among health plans and built predictive models to forecast the financial impact of healthcare legislation on key stakeholders. She played an integral part in creating the business development strategy for the firm's Medicare Part D business line and kept clients informed about pertinent Medicare policy developments that would likely impact their businesses.
